A Sum of Many Parts, Undefeated in Multiple Wins 

Globe has once again proven its unparalleled dominance in the telco industry with a series of wins that reflect different facets of excellence. The sum of these parts solidifies Globe’s position as the foremost mobile network in the country.

Globe’s commitment to mobile network reliability has been acknowledged five times in a row by Ookla®, the global leader in internet testing and analysis, with Globe achieving the highest Consistency Score™ and availability in all-technology mobile networks.

Brand Finance, on the other hand, recognized Globe’s robust mobile and corporate data business performance, 5G network expansion, and the sustained growth of its non-telco services, all of which are coupled with the company’s dedication to sustainability and reducing greenhouse gas emissions. This culminated in Globe being named the Philippines’ strongest brand, boasting an impressive AAA rating.

Additionally, Globe made it to Asia Pacific’s Climate Leaders by the Financial Times and Statista for two consecutive years. Globe is the only Philippine telco included in this year’s lineup, proving its commitment to climate action, backed by energy-efficient technologies and green network operations.

Globe’s focus on customer-centricity, sustainability, and innovation has led to four wins in the Consumer Choice Awards conducted by Standard Insights, including Best Network Reliability, Best Prices & Offers, Best Branding & Marketing, and Most Sustainability-Driven Network awards.

The leading digital solutions platform also earned an AA rating by MSCI, a first for the homegrown company and for a Philippine-based company to be given such rating.

Likewise, its core telco brand and affiliate GCash have emerged as the most endeared brands in the latest PAHAYAG survey by PUBLiCUS Asia.
